Another Ola S1 Pro owner shares images of broken front suspension at 35 kmph


Recently, we came across an incident where the front suspension of an Ola S1 Pro electric scooter. The front suspension broke while riding at the speed of 35 kmph. The lad who was riding the scooter was admitted to ICU due to injuries. Ola did come up with an official response in this matter and told that their preliminary investigation has revealed that this was a case of very high impact road accident. After the reports of this accident went viral, we now have another customer who has come forward with pictures of his Ola S1 pro scooter with a broken front suspension.

The owner of this Ola S1 Pro electric scooter had shared images of his scooter on Twitter. He recalls the incident in a post that he shared on Team-bhp. He calls himself the impacted user. He calls himself as one of the few who believed in Bhavesh’s Pitch and trusted the Product even before it was launched. The accident happened on November 10 last year. The user had picked her daughter back from school. He was almost near his home in Bengaluru when this incident happened. He was riding through a service lane to avoid traffic. The roads had few potholes in it and he was carrying a speed of 35 kmph.

Suddenly he felt like loosing balance and the front wheel suddenly buckled in. He lost control on the scooter and as it was an unexpected incident, the rider’s upper body hit the handle bar and his daughter hit him on the back. The rider was wearing a proper helmet and even the front suspension broke, both of them were thrown on to the road. He felt like something heavy crashed on to his chest. He mentions that it took him few seconds to start breathing normally. He sat on the side of the road and dialed his wife to come and pick him up.

After the incident, he called Ola’s customer care and explained the situation to them. He reached to Ola Bangalore group and the news reached Ola Service Head and Senior Management. He was satisfied with the way Ola’s team handled the issue. They got in touch with the customer and took the scooter. The fixed the issue and returned it back to the customer within 24 hours. After the incident, the service manager even made a courtesy visit along with the vehicle to ensure that everything was fine. Although, his issue got fixed, the customer is still worried about the design of the front suspension on scooter. This is not the first time, Ola electric scooters have come in news.

After the first incident, Ola has come up with explanation. They have said that they have more than 1.5 lakh vehicles on the roads and until now, only a few isolated cases of suspension breaking have come up. Customers who think that there is a problem with the suspension of their Ola S1 Pro can get it checked through the service network of Ola. When the scooter was initially launched in the market, it had several issues. The scooter had several software glitches which were eventually fixed over updates.
